Why is Injury Prevention Important in Sports?
Injuries are a common part of sports, but many of them are preventable. When left unchecked, even minor injuries can lead to long-term issues that impact performance and overall quality of life. By focusing on injury prevention, athletes can:
- Avoid downtime caused by recovery
- Enhance performance through better physical condition
- Reduce the risk of chronic pain or re-injury
- Maintain overall health and well-being
From muscle strains to ligament tears, sports-related injuries can be frustrating and debilitating, but with the right precautions, you can protect your body and enjoy your favorite activities without interruption.
Key Strategies for Preventing Sports Injuries
Preventing injuries requires a proactive approach that includes preparation, conditioning, and mindfulness during play. Here are some of the most effective ways to prevent injuries:
1. Warm Up and Cool Down
Always start your workout or game with a proper warm-up to prepare your body for physical activity. Gentle movements like jogging, dynamic stretches, or light cardio can increase blood flow and loosen muscles. Similarly, cooling down after exercise helps reduce stiffness and aids in recovery.
2. Focus on Flexibility
Increased flexibility can reduce the risk of strains and sprains. Incorporating stretches into your routine, such as yoga or static stretching, improves joint mobility and muscle elasticity, keeping your body ready for action.
3. Strength Training
Building strength in your core, legs, and other key muscle groups provides better support for your joints and reduces the likelihood of injury. A well-rounded training program that includes resistance exercises can improve stability and balance.
4. Use Proper Equipment
Wearing the right gear is crucial. Ensure your shoes, pads, helmets, and other equipment are the right size, in good condition, and suitable for your sport. Proper equipment provides protection and reduces the impact on vulnerable areas.
5. Practice Good Technique
Learning and maintaining proper form is essential for preventing injuries. Poor technique puts unnecessary stress on your body and increases the risk of accidents. Work with a coach or trainer to ensure you’re using the correct methods.
6. Listen to Your Body
Overtraining or ignoring signs of fatigue can lead to injury. Pay attention to your body’s signals, such as pain, discomfort, or extreme tiredness, and give yourself adequate rest to recover.
How Can Physical Therapy Help Prevent Sports Injuries?
Physical therapy is not just for recovery—it’s also a powerful tool for injury prevention. Therapists can assess your body’s strengths and weaknesses, identify potential risk areas, and create a personalized plan to address them. Here’s how physical therapy supports injury prevention:
- Strength and Conditioning: Targeted exercises build muscle strength and joint stability.
- Flexibility and Mobility Training: Stretching routines improve range of motion and reduce stiffness.
- Balance and Coordination Drills: These exercises enhance body control, lowering the risk of falls or awkward movements.
- Education and Guidance: Therapists teach you how to perform exercises and movements safely, reducing strain and injury risk.

Tips for Staying Safe During Sports
In addition to the strategies above, here are some extra tips to help you stay safe while enjoying your favorite activities:
- Stay hydrated to keep your muscles and joints functioning properly.
- Take rest days to allow your body to recover and avoid overuse injuries.
- Gradually increase the intensity of your workouts or practices to prevent sudden strain.
- Be mindful of your playing environment, including weather, surface conditions, and equipment setup.
By integrating these habits into your routine, you can significantly reduce your risk of injury and stay in the game.
